Daniel O'Keefe rated this wine as 89/100 with the following review:

This organic Shiraz is crafted from grapes grown in the Angove Nanya Vineyard and in other premium certified organic vineyards within McLaren Vale. Ripe and fruity with blackberry, plum, and black cherry aromas accented by black pepper and cocoa. Edging towards jammy, but vibrant acidity ensures it remains fresh and food friendly. Combined with a full body and decent tannins, this Shiraz will impress alongside pepper steaks, hearty stews, and grilled burgers any time over the next few years. Terrific value.

Jennifer Havers - WSET Level 3 rated this wine as 88/100 with the following review:

Aromas of blueberry, blackberry, vanilla and spice. Full bodied and smooth with medium acidity, and ripe fruit and berry notes on the palate. Enjoy with BBQ ribs or any meat featuring a tangy BBQ sauce.
Andrea Shapiro rated this wine as 88/100 with the following review:

A budget friendly organic Aussie Shiraz for quite a reasonable price. Excellent QPR, available locally for $14.95. Red, fleshy plum fruit with an intricate amount of spice. Flavours follow through with elements of dark chocolate, and chalkly stone driven undertones. Lively acidity shines, with a medium body and finish that reveal some persistence of vanilla beans and juicy pomegranate carrying into the back. An awesome pairing for barbecued ribs. 88 points
